Understanding Daily Life Within Sober Living Communities
Residing within a sober living facility mirrors many aspects of rehabilitation, yet here individuals maintain employment or educational pursuits while preserving financial autonomy. Group sessions and support networks remain integral components, though residents enjoy freedom to enter and exit the facility at will. Curfew restrictions, zero-tolerance substance policies, and established guidelines continue ensuring all inhabitants flourish within a nurturing, uplifting atmosphere.
Halfway houses represent another term for sober living arrangements since residents complete half their recovery journey. Beyond simply cohabitating with recovering housemates, these environments deliver less rigid structures compared to rehabilitation centers while providing greater guidance than returning to unstructured home settings. Essential life competencies get developed through sober living programs before residents transition to independent living, including:
- SECURING EMPLOYMENT
- LOCATING POST-TREATMENT HOUSING
- MAINTAINING HOME SOBRIETY
- INTERPERSONAL ABILITIES
- RESTORING FAMILY CONNECTIONS
- BUILDING SUPPORT SYSTEMS
- HANDLING PERSONAL TRIGGERS
- CONTINUING EDUCATIONAL GOALS
Distinguishing Sober Living From Halfway Houses
Both sober living facilities and halfway houses serve as residential support systems for individuals recovering from addiction. Despite sharing common objectives, these community types present distinct differences worth examining.
Structured environments characterize sober living homes, specifically designed for those completing formal addiction treatment programs while working toward independent living and sustained sobriety. Greater freedom typically defines sober living compared to halfway houses, allowing residents increased autonomy regarding curfews, visitor policies, and technology access. Sobriety maintenance, group participation, household contribution responsibilities, and personal expense management remain expected of all residents.
Court-mandated treatment programs often utilize halfway houses, which feature more stringent structural requirements. Individuals completing residential treatment who need additional supervision and support during community reintegration frequently utilize these facilities. Mandatory curfews, regular drug screening, and stricter regulations commonly govern halfway house residents.
Service levels and support offerings represent another distinguishing factor between sober living homes and halfway houses. Although both residential environments may provide counseling access and support group participation, halfway houses often deliver more intensive therapeutic services and medical care addressing specific mental health requirements.
Ultimately, both sober living homes and halfway houses create supportive, secure environments where recovering individuals establish foundations for healthy, meaningful sobriety. Choosing between these residential options depends on individual needs, circumstances, and required support levels for maintaining sobriety.

Duration Expectations For Sober Living Residency
Typical sober living home stays average 90 days, though extended arrangements accommodate individual needs. Concerns about maintaining sobriety within personal home environments after rehabilitation, or negative family attitudes toward recovery, make sober living or halfway houses excellent solutions for staying committed. Professional support within sober living environments assists with navigating major life changes. Determining appropriate stay lengths receives professional guidance tailored to individual circumstances.
Active recovery pursuit, community rule adherence, and payment responsibilities allow extended sober living community residence as needed. Recovery experiences from substance dependencies vary uniquely among individuals, prompting the best sober living communities to adopt flexible approaches accommodating these differences.
Insurance Coverage For Sober Living Facilities
Personal rent payments and household chores typically characterize most sober living home requirements for residents. Generally speaking, insurance coverage rarely extends to sober living homes since government classification doesn’t recognize them as treatment facilities. Treatment services aren’t provided by sober living homes unlike rehabilitation facilities. Although seemingly disadvantageous, rent payment responsibilities help residents maintain responsible financial practices.
Outpatient rehabilitation attended during sober living residency may qualify for insurance coverage, however. Care provider limitations or cost contributions may apply depending on specific insurance policies. Costs depend on policy deductibles and co-payment requirements. Treatment facility staff typically assist in determining outpatient rehabilitation insurance eligibility.

Sober living house definitions include what characteristics?
Sober living houses, alternatively called sober living communities, represent residential settings where individuals recovering from substance dependencies live within safe, supportive environments alongside peers undergoing recovery journeys committed to sobriety. Transitional steps frequently utilize sober living houses for people completing inpatient treatment programs not yet prepared for everyday living transitions. Structured, substance-free environments with house rules and guidelines help residents maintain sobriety while developing life skills supporting recovery. House managers typically oversee daily operations and enforce established rules. Active recovery participation usually requires residents to attend outpatient therapy sessions or engage with peer support group meetings. Household chore and responsibility sharing expectations apply to residents. Addiction treatment isnโt provided by sober living homes, and these communities donโt substitute for rehabilitation programs.
